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e.
All database projects are shown in a flat list in the extension. We previously used VS to have solutions for different nodes with the same database names below them. In VSC, the databases show up in order of folder structure, but folder structure is not visible. As the databases / project names are equal, this creates confusion.
Describe the solution or feature you'd like
An option to respect the folder structure and show that as a hierarchal tree in the database projects pane.
Describe alternatives you've considered
Use some kind of annotation from the project files / manual grouping / workspace config file.
